A 5-year prisoner was released from a colony in Mykolaiv region to serve in the army

(COLLAGE: Channel 24)

In Mykolaiv region, a convicted man was released for contract military service. He was placed under two-year administrative supervision and restricted from moving outside the military unit.

This is evidenced by the ruling of the Voznesensk City District Court of Mykolaiv Oblast.

The court decided to release the convict from the colony on parole to perform military service under a contract. The convict was serving his sentence in the Voznesensk Penal Colony No. 72 for theft on a large scale.

This is a man who was sentenced to five years in prison in January 2024. At first, he was given a suspended sentence, but in March 2025, the court canceled the probationary period, and the convict was sent to the colony. He began serving his sentence on April 1, 2025.

However, in early May, the convict appealed to the colony administration with a request to release him for military service. According to the results of the medical commission, he was found fit. He also had a written consent from the military unit, which was ready to accept him as a rifleman in the specialized battalion "Shkval".

The court, having heard all the parties, granted the colony administration's request. Thus, the man was released from further serving his sentence for 4 years, 10 months and 17 days.

According to the court's decision, within 24 hours after the ruling came into force, he must report to the military commissariat accompanied by the National Guard. In addition, he was placed under administrative supervision for two years. He is forbidden to leave the location of the military unit without the permission of the commander.

In April, the Voznesensk City District Court also allowed the convict to be released from the colony to do military service under contract. In 2024, the Ovidiopol District Court sentenced him to seven years in prison with confiscation of property, and he served his sentence in penal colony #72, where he was supposed to stay until April 2030.

However, in March 2025, the man asked the court to allow him to join the Armed Forces of Ukraine. The administration of the colony supported his application and filed a corresponding petition.
